Smith Bullish on whole deal

"We needed another big who could shoot if we couldn't get a legitimate post player"

Other than one season playing alongside Ben Wallace with the Pistons, Joe Smith's only association with anyone with the Bulls is a July 5 meeting with general manager John Paxson and coach Scott Skiles.

'That's OK, because I'm not a hard guy to get along with,' Smith said Saturday in a phone interview. 'I have a laid-back personality. I like to joke around. But when the ball goes up, I like to come in and take care of business. I want to win.'

That shared desire is why Paxson and Skiles are happy and why Smith is beaming for reasons beyond the two-year, $10 million deal he will sign Tuesday, barring an unexpected blip with his physical. Read more
